Use3D said:

This looks good! It doesn't run under doom.exe though...

As a matter of fact doom.exe is precisely what Phobos Revisited is designed for. The whole point is to make the map-set playable under vanilla DooM -- while adding architectural detail to the greatest extent possible without triggering VPO errors, and making the gameply more challenging.

I wonder what gave you the impression that it doesn't run under doom.exe.
